Flat Panel Detector
Specifications
• Detector technology: Wireless a-Si Flat Panel Detector
• Scintillator material: CsI
• Images size: 350mm x 430mm
• Static pixel matrix: 2500 x 3052pixels
• Effective pixels: 7.60million
• Pixel size: 140μm
• Spatial resolution: 3.5lp/mm
• Output grayscale: 16bit
• Acquisition time: ≤7s
High Frequency Generator
Specifications
• Nominal output power: 32kW
• Max output power: 40kW
• Frequency: 50kHz/60kHz±1Hz
• kV range: 40~150kV, 1kV step
• mA range: 50-400mA
• mAs range: 1~630mAs
• Input power: 220V
